Only Child return to celebrate the release of their fifth LP. Alan O'Hare's eclectic ensemble play emotional music, with an emphasis on storytelling. Built from folk roots, with the sounds of acoustic guitar and fiddle dominating, the music has been compared to The Waterboys, Van Morrison and Dexys. Only Child have released four critically acclaimed albums and three EPs since 2012.
Tonight, they will be joined by special guest Jeff Young, a writer for radio, television, stage and screen, and one of BBC Radio Drama's most acclaimed dramatists. He has worked on many arts projects in Liverpool, including with Bill Drummond. The author of the Costa-shortlisted Ghost Town, Jeff's latest release, Wild Twin, is a love song to cities.
